Phone number ☎️ 0102023635 👆 is reported as a persistent scam involving callers claiming to be from Microsoft or Windows technical support, often with foreign accents, trying to gain remote access to victims' computers. Many complain about aggressive or abusive behaviour when challenged and note suspicious tactics like vague technical jargon or requests for personal and computer information. Some have experienced dead calls or automated messages, while others have been targeted multiple times. The callers frequently appear unconcerned when confronted, hang up abruptly, or become hostile. Several users suspect the aim is to steal personal details or money, especially from vulnerable individuals, including the elderly. Overall, the number is widely regarded as dangerous, deceptive, and best avoided.
